共用方式為


Get-SCSMDeletedItem

擷取已在 Service Manager 中標示要刪除的專案。

語法

Get-SCSMDeletedItem
   [[-DisplayName] <String[]>]
   [-SCSession <Connection[]>]
   [-ComputerName <String[]>]
   [-Credential <PSCredential>]
   [<CommonParameters>]
Get-SCSMDeletedItem
   [-Id] <Guid[]>
   [-SCSession <Connection[]>]
   [-ComputerName <String[]>]
   [-Credential <PSCredential>]
   [<CommonParameters>]
Get-SCSMDeletedItem
   [-Name] <String[]>
   [-SCSession <Connection[]>]
   [-ComputerName <String[]>]
   [-Credential <PSCredential>]
   [<CommonParameters>]

Description

Get-SCSMDeleteditem Cmdlet 會擷取已在 Service Manager 中標示要刪除的專案。 接著,您可以使用 Restore-SCSMDeletedItem Cmdlet 來還原這些專案。

範例

範例 1:取得已刪除的專案

C:\PS>Get-SCSMDeleteditem
UserName  Domain FirstName LastName
--------  ------ --------- --------
Dave.Chew JWT-D4 Dave      Chew

此命令會從 Service Manager 資料庫擷取已刪除的專案。

參數

-ComputerName

指定 System Center 資料存取服務執行所在的電腦名稱。 Credential 參數中指定的使用者帳戶必須具有指定計算機的訪問許可權。

類型:System.String[]
Position:Named
預設值:Localhost
必要:False
接受管線輸入:False
接受萬用字元:False

-Credential

指定此 Cmdlet 用來連線到 System Center 資料存取服務執行所在的伺服器認證。 指定的使用者帳戶必須具有該伺服器的訪問許可權。

類型:System.Management.Automation.PSCredential
Position:Named
預設值:None
必要:False
接受管線輸入:False
接受萬用字元:False

-DisplayName

指定要擷取之已刪除專案的 DisplayName。 這可以是正則表達式。

類型:System.String[]
Position:0
預設值:None
必要:False
接受管線輸入:True
接受萬用字元:False

-Id

指定要擷取之已刪除項目的標識碼。

類型:System.Guid[]
Position:0
預設值:None
必要:True
接受管線輸入:True
接受萬用字元:False

-Name

指定要擷取之已刪除項目的名稱。 您可以指定正規表示式。

類型:System.String[]
Position:0
預設值:None
必要:True
接受管線輸入:False
接受萬用字元:False

-SCSession

指定物件,表示 Service Manager 管理伺服器的會話。

類型:Microsoft.SystemCenter.Core.Connection.Connection[]
Position:Named
預設值:None
必要:False
接受管線輸入:False
接受萬用字元:False

輸入

System.String

您可以使用管線將名稱傳送至 DisplayName 參數。

System.Guid

您可以使用管線將 GUID 傳送至 Id 參數。

輸出

The type of object that is being deleted.

此 Cmdlet 會擷取已標示要從 Service Manager 資料庫刪除的專案。